When did you last pay a visit to your dentist? Have you ever pondered upon the idea that your oral health could be a mirror reflecting your overall health?
The field of biomedical research has experienced remarkable advancements over the past decade, but few have made as much of an impact as 3D cell cultures. These innovative models have revolutionized ...